    Our client, a reputable international school, is seeking an enthusiastic and dedicated English Teacher. This role is ideal for educators who thrive in a diverse learning environment and are passionate about inspiring young learners.
    Bukit PanjangMonday - Friday (8am - 5pm)
    Key ResponsibilitiesDesign and implement engaging EAL lessons that are differentiated to support students with varying levels of English proficiencyIncorporate both the Cambridge International Curriculum and WIDA (World-class Instructional Design and Assessment) standards into teaching and assessmentsUtilise a range of teaching methods and educational technology to support language acquisition, including multimedia, collaborative projects, and individual workConduct baseline assessments of students’ English language proficiency upon entryMonitor progress through formative assessments and adapt instruction accordinglyRe-assess students at the end of each term to evaluate progress and inform future instructionStay current with research and best practices in EAL teaching, including the use of WIDA standardsProvide detailed reports to parents regarding student progress and areas for improvementParticipate in school-based professional development programs, contributing to the wider school communityWork with school leadership to continually refine and improve the EAL program
    RequirementsDegree in Education, TESOL, Applied Linguistics, or a related fieldRecognized teaching qualification, preferably with a specialization in EAL or ESL (e.g., CELTA, DELTA, PGCE)Experience teaching EAL or ESL to primary or secondary students, ideally within an international school settingFamiliarity with the Cambridge International Curriculum is preferredExperience with WIDA standards and assessments is a significant advantageProven track record of supporting diverse learners and adapting teaching strategies to meet individual needsStrong understanding of English language acquisition and effective strategies for supporting EAL learnersExcellent inter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to build strong relationships with students, staff, and parentsCultural sensitivity and awareness, with the ability to work effectively in a diverse, international school environmentAbility to use technology to enhance language learning, including the use of online resources, multimedia tools, and educational platforms

    A leading systems integrator in Singapore our Client is looking for a stellar Systems Engineer to join their growing team here in Singapore.
    Key ResponsibilitiesProject ImplementationLead or contribute to the rollout of turnkey solutions for public sector clients.Set up, configure, and validate IT and telecom platforms, ensuring proper handover into operations.Carry out OS hardening, patch management, and vulnerability fixes based on compliance benchmarks (e.g. CIS).Draft technical guides, security checklists, and troubleshooting notes.Operations & SupportProvide rotational 24/7 support for high-availability systems.Diagnose and resolve escalated issues across servers, networks, and firewalls.Conduct vulnerability testing and apply remediation in line with policy.Work closely with global vendors to manage escalations and technical updates.Stakeholder EngagementServe as the technical point of contact for clients, aligning solutions with requirements and constraints.Deliver workshops, technical briefings, and compliance reviews.Liaise with vendors on integration, upgrades, and security advisories.
    What We’re Looking ForEducation: Diploma or Degree in Engineering, Computer Science, or similar field. Specialisation in Cybersecurity, Software/Communications Engineering, AI, or Data Analytics is an advantage.Certifications: CCNP, RHCE, VMware VCP, CISSP, CEH, OSCP, Fortinet NSE, Palo Alto PCNSE, AWS, or CKA are highly valued.Systems: Strong hands-on experience with Linux (RHEL, CentOS, Ubuntu) and Windows Server; knowledge of CIS benchmarks and patch compliance.Networking: Familiar with Cisco/Dell switches (L2/L3, VLANs, routing, spanning tree, BGP); solid troubleshooting of TCP/IP environments.Security: Practical exposure to Fortinet or Palo Alto firewalls (VPNs, NAT, security rules, threat prevention); able to run and remediate VAPT.Compliance: Awareness of IM8, ISO27001, PDPA, and government guidelines; experience preparing audits or compliance reviews.Virtualisation & Cloud: VMware, Hyper-V, or OpenStack; containers (Docker/Kubernetes/Tanzu) and public cloud (AWS/Azure) beneficial.Databases: Exposure to MySQL, PostgreSQL, or Oracle.Soft Skills: Strong analytical approach, clear communicator across technical/non-technical audiences, team-oriented yet self-driven.Others: Able to support on-call requirements and open to occasional travel.
